Output 70e7fae8bd1f8d63bc3870cf20c21a198e2219969e0f95bd066e498fce564d9b:0

value
1843376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1449042a442d102e657a7d16bf4d70d17c55a468 OP_EQUAL
address
33YGue4L69m3AzG3httydexa4qi1RsjrMf
transaction
70e7fae8bd1f8d63bc3870cf20c21a198e2219969e0f95bd066e498fce564d9b
confirmations
258133
spent
true